@wdp4wdm3a5 жыл бұрын
Some more suggestions : *Check the rivers and forests behind fri, turquoise waters everywhere. *Explore Rajaji national park, Chilla road (which lies in the national park). *Maldevta, Sahastradhara, Robbers cave. *Roads to Kandoli, Bidholi, Sudhowala and all nearby roads. *Go up to the hills and follow tons river from Dakpatthar upstream. *Visit assan barrage, amazing place for birdwatching in the winters. *Bhadraj is still the best place, highest point in dehradun (2300m) and offers incredible views of Swargarohini, bandarpunch massif, kedar dome and chaukhamba. *You can stargaze from Bhadraj, the milky way is clearly visible witha million stars, the hike is gorgeous. *If you want to visit heaven in Uttarakhand then go anywhere above 3500m. Har ki dun, kedarkantha, Nilkanth base camp, Panch kedar treks, Auden col, panpatia col trek, gangotri gomukh tapovan trek, Bali pass, Dodital, Darma valley, valley of flowers, hem kund sahib, Kuari pass, nanda devi east base camp, panchchuli base camp, adi kailash. You will be absolutely blown away and if you visit even one of these places you will perhaps never even think of blowing money on a foreign destination. Also, follow no trace policy and never litter. Dehradun city will give you double rainbows, hailstorms, snowfalls, amazing sunsets and a lifetime of memories. Never litter and always dispose the garbage in the dustbin.
